5. Le Pont Jacques-Gabriel: A Scenic Landmark Bridge
Le Pont Jacques-Gabriel is one of the most picturesque landmarks in Blois. This stunning bridge, spanning the Loire River, connects the two sides of the city and offers bre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. Constructed in the early 18th century, its elegant archways and historical significance make it a must-visit site.
As you stroll across the bridge, you’ll enjoy panoramic vistas of the river and the vibrant city life. Not only does the bridge serve a practical purpose, but it also enhances the overall aesthetic of Blois. In summer, the area comes alive with picnics and leisure Activities along the riverbanks.

9. Blois’ Tower of François I: A Perspective on Renaissance Architecture
The Tower of François I stands as a magnificent example of Renaissance architecture in Blois. This majestic structure is part of the larger Château de Blois complex and serves as a symbol of the town’s royal past. Its ornate design is characterized by elegant turrets and intricate details that will impress all visitors.
As you explore this landmark, you’ll learn about the history related to King François I. Additionally, the tower offers visitors a chance to gain insight into the architectural innovations of the Renaissance period. Moreover, the views from its heights provide a breathtaking panorama of the surrounding landscapes.
